NavyVeteran Posted March 20, 2017 #9 Share Posted March 20, 2017 If you don't respond immediately, it may be too late by the time you contact them. They send the offer to more people than they have upsells available, and first to respond gets it. They give you a phone number to call. You will probably get voice mail - particularly if it is after business hours. They will then call back the next morning. If and when you talk with them, they will tell you what suites are available and at what price. You need to have done you homework in advance so you can respond immediately. Look at the deck plans and make sure you know every available suite and which ones you are willing to take. Although all suites have the same perks, different suites have different advantages and disadvantages in location, size, and layout. For example, a suite with a forward facing balcony may have the balcony unusable while underway.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

NavyVeteran Posted March 21, 2017 #22 Share Posted March 21, 2017 If memory serves me right, full suites get priority over elites when it comes to the laundry.....:):):) Bob Suites receive free same day laundry service. Elites receive free next day laundry service. I was on the same trans-Atlantic with Bob with a large number of Elites. Because of the large number of Elites, Elite laundry service sometimes took three or four days instead of the advertised two. However, suite laundry service was not affected. Put your laundry out early in the morning and it was back that evening. I normally put mine out the night before, since I normally bathe and change before dinner - not in the morning. The laundry was always back the next evening.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
